When a site loses its licence from the UK Gambling Commission, it’s not just a bureaucratic hiccup – it shakes up everything for players, operators, and even the broader market.
Immediate consequences for players
First off, if you’ve got funds stuck in an account, those can become impossible to withdraw. The site might still try to keep you playing, but the regulator can step in and freeze assets.
Regulatory fallout
The UKGC can issue penalties, force the site to shut down, or even blacklist it. That sends a clear message to other operators: cut corners and you’ll feel the heat.

How to spot a risky operator
Look for clear licence numbers, transparent terms, and a solid track record of payouts. If something feels off, chances are the site might be skating close to the edge.
